As mentioned previously, Windows Mobile 5 Smartphone does not have a notes application (unlike WM5 PPC, which does have a notes app). If the BlackJack has a notes app, it's not one provided by the O/S. It would be something added on by either the maker of the BlackJack, or by the carrier.

For the Q you have to acquire a third party notes app.
